然而,对于初学者而言,如何将外部文件导入MySQL数据库,以及如何正确打开和操作这些文件,可能会成为一道难题
本文将详细介绍MySQL文件的导入与打开方法,确保您能够轻松掌握这一关键技能
一、MySQL文件导入前的准备工作 在导入MySQL文件之前,您需要确保以下几点: 1.安装MySQL数据库:首先,您需要从MySQL官方网站下载并安装最新版本的MySQL数据库软件
根据您的操作系统选择合适的版本,并按照安装向导进行安装
安装完成后,您可以通过命令行终端(如Windows下的cmd或Linux、Mac下的Terminal)来访问MySQL
2.创建目标数据库:在导入文件之前,您需要确保目标数据库已经存在
如果尚未创建,您可以使用MySQL客户端或命令行来创建一个新的数据库
例如,使用命令行时,可以输入`CREATE DATABASE database_name;`来创建一个名为`database_name`的新数据库
3.准备要导入的文件:确保您要导入的文件(通常是SQL文件)格式正确,且内容符合MySQL的语法规范
如果文件是从其他数据库系统导出的,可能需要进行一些格式调整
二、MySQL文件导入方法详解 MySQL文件的导入方法多种多样,以下是几种常见且高效的方法: 方法一:使用命令行导入 命令行导入是一种直接且高效的方法,适用于熟悉MySQL命令行的用户
具体步骤如下: 1.打开命令行终端:在Windows系统中,按下Win键并输入“cmd”来打开命令行终端;在Linux和Mac系统中,使用终端应用程序来打开命令行终端
2.进入MySQL安装目录:使用cd命令切换到MySQL安装目录的bin文件下
例如,在Windows系统中,可能是`C:Program FilesMySQLMySQL Server X.Ybin`
3.连接到MySQL服务器:输入`mysql -u username -p`命令并回车,其中`username`是您的MySQL用户名
系统会提示您输入密码,输入正确密码后即可连接到MySQL服务器
4.选择目标数据库:使用`USE database_name;`命令来选择要导入文件的目标数据库
5.执行导入命令:使用`SOURCE /path/to/file.sql;`命令来导入SQL文件
请将`/path/to/file.sql`替换为您要导入的SQL文件的实际路径
方法二:使用图形化工具导入 对于不熟悉命令行的用户,图形化工具如MySQL Workbench、phpMyAdmin和Navicat等提供了更为直观和友好的导入方式
1.MySQL Workbench: 打开MySQL Workbench并连接到目标数据库
- 在菜单栏中选择“Server”->“Data Import”
- 在弹出的窗口中,选择要导入的SQL文件路径,并点击“Start Import”按钮开始导入
导入完成后,刷新数据库以查看新导入的数据
2.phpMyAdmin: - 打开phpMyAdmin网页界面,并登录到您的MySQL服务器
在左侧窗格中选择目标数据库
点击顶部的“导入”选项卡
- 在“文件到导入”部分,点击“浏览”按钮选择要导入的SQL文件
- 配置其他导入选项(如字符集、压缩等),然后点击“执行”按钮开始导入
3.Navicat: 打开Navicat并连接到MySQL服务器
- 在左侧导航栏中找到并右击目标数据库,选择“新建数据库”以创建数据库(如果尚未创建)
- 选中目标数据库,在右侧窗格中找到“运行SQL文件”选项
- 在弹出的窗口中,选择要导入的SQL文件路径,并点击“开始”按钮开始导入
方法三:使用编程语言导入 对于需要自动化导入过程的场景,您可以使用编程语言(如Python、Java等)来编写脚本,通过MySQL客户端库连接到数据库并执行导入命令
这种方法需要一定的编程基础和对MySQL客户端库的了解
三、MySQL文件打开与操作 导入MySQL文件后,您可能需要查看或操作数据库中的数据
以下是一些常用的打开与操作方法: 1.使用MySQL客户端查看数据: - 打开MySQL客户端(如MySQL Command Line Client或MySQL Workbench)
连接到目标数据库
- 使用SHOW TABLES;命令查看数据库中的表列表
- 使用`SELECT FROM table_name;`命令查看特定表中的数据
2.使用图形化工具查看数据: - 在MySQL Workbench、phpMyAdmin或Navicat等工具中,导航到目标数据库
- 在表列表中双击要查看的表,即可在右侧窗格中查看表中的数据
3.数据操作与修改: - 您可以使用SQL语句来插入、更新或删除数据库中的数据
例如,使用`INSERT INTO`语句插入新数据,使用`UPDATE`语句修改现有数据,使用`DELETE`语句删除数据
- 在图形化工具中,您通常可以通过界面上的按钮或菜单选项来执行这些操作,而无需手动编写SQL语句
四、常见问题与解决方案 在导入MySQL文件的过程中,您可能会遇到一些常见问题
以下是一些常见问题及其解决方案: 1.文件格式不正确:确保您要导入的SQL文件格式正确,且符合MySQL的语法规范
如果文件是从其他数据库系统导出的,请检查并调整格式
2.数据库权限不足:确保您有足够的权限来访问和修改目标数据库
如果权限不足,请联系数据库管理员进行授权
3.文件路径不正确:在导入命令中指定正确的文件路径
如果路径包含空格或特殊字符,请确保使用引号将其括起来
4.导入失败或数据不完整:检查SQL文件是否包含语法错误或数据不一致的问题
您可以使用MySQL的日志功能来查看导入过程中的错误信息,并根据错误信息进行排查和修复
五、总结 本文详细介绍了MySQL文件的导入与打开方法,包括命令行导入、图形化工具导入和使用编程语言导入等多种方式
同时,还提供了查看和操作数据库中的数据的方法以及常见问题的解决方案
通过本文的学习,您将能够轻松掌握MySQL文件的导入与打开技能,为数据库管理和开发工作打下坚实的基础
无论您是初学者还是经验丰富的开发者,本文都将为您提供有价值的参考和指导
MFC连接MySQL程序下载指南
MySQL数据库:轻松导入文件与打开教程指南
MySQL除数取余技巧解析
MySQL与BAT脚本的奇妙相遇
MySQL最大整型数据类型详解
揭秘MySQL:高效数据读写流程全解析
MySQL为何选B树弃哈希?揭秘原因
MFC连接MySQL程序下载指南
MySQL除数取余技巧解析
MySQL与BAT脚本的奇妙相遇
MySQL最大整型数据类型详解
揭秘MySQL:高效数据读写流程全解析
MySQL为何选B树弃哈希?揭秘原因
MySQL为何如此内存占用高?
MySQL实战:高效计算数据占比的函数应用指南
如何检查MySQL表是否被锁定
MySQL服务器配置文件名称揭秘
pgAdmin3无法直连MySQL,解决方案揭秘
Win10系统下MySQL5.5.28安装指南:详细步骤解析